How Sleep Apnea Can Worsen Your Asthma

WebThe logic goes like this: Allergies create nasal congestion. Nasal congestion can dry out your mouth, or block your breathing airways. Both of these factors can lead to “apneas” – the stops in breathing overnight that characterize obstructive sleep apnea (OSA). Allergy Asthma Clin … WebAllergic rhinitis increases the risk of developing obstructive sleep apnea by two major mechanisms: 1) increase in airway resistance due to higher nasal resistance and 2) reduction in pharyngeal diameter from mouth breathing that moves the mandible inferiorly. Alternatively, obstructive sleep apnea WebOct 28, 2010 · Here are 3 ways that sleep apnea can aggravate or cause asthma: 1. It’s been shown that repeated apneas can cause a vacuum effect in the throat that can suction up your normal stomach juices into your throat. Sleep apnea is a sleep-related breathing disorder that causes a person to experience multiple pauses in breathing or episodes of shallow breathing during sleep. Those with sleep apnea may present with PND , causing disrupted sleep and nighttime awakenings.
